Dawn was feeling heavy. She stopped breathing. These people were writing her life and she didn't even know about it. Azura kept her in the dark. So many conspiracies swirled around her. Her knees were wobbly. Avarice and selfishness had driven these hungry wolves to a derogatory level.
Niall patted the wooden bench on the side and said, "Sit down Dawn. You are going to need all your courage."
When Dawn didn't budge from her place Niall shrugged and twisted her mouth. "Your wish." She sipped more of her drink. "Azura's hopes rekindled when he saw your photo on Jason's phone. He threatened Jason to not touch you.
"Jason and Azura are partners in many businesses. Since Azura is the leader of neotides, his partnership comes with its perks. So Jason made a deal with Azura. The deal was to get back his gaming company from Daryn by using your expertise in exchange of sparing you. We decided that you are going to stay anonymously in Bainsburgh, and once we will get The Jupiter Inc. back, Azura would take you away someplace else and marry you. That ways everything would have settled down quietly but you Dawn, you—" Niall laughed like a mad and looked up at the sky. "You seduced the CEO of The Silver House. Your greediness took over you! You stole him from Maya!"
Dawn narrowed her eyes at her and crossed her arms across her chest.
Niall's face became red with fury. She said, "You disappeared from the grid. You didn't get the information Azura asked you to and put him in a lurch. Jason was so sure that he would again become the CEO of The Jupiter Inc. but you thrashed his plans. You even did a hostile takeover of his company Neo Software." Niall was shaking at this point. "Dawn, you vile, you think that Jason is going to tolerate it? He will show you what it is to mess with him. Today he is going to snatch his company back and put you on the stakes. Everyone present here will know your true colors. We will expose you and your greediness. Did you think that we wouldn't come to know that you have launched a new game?" Niall laughed as her shoulders shook. "Even Maya is going to ruin you. After today, you won't see the light of the day."
Advertisement
Dawn tilted her head and asked, "Why are you so interested in Jason?"
She brought her hand forward to display the diamond ring she was wearing. "Look at this. We will be marrying soon."
Dawn scoffed and shook her head. "All that jewelry you are wearing, it belongs to me. Jason bought it from my father's money."
Niall's face twisted. "Then watch me wearing it nicely because you will never get it." She got up and started to walk back. Suddenly she stopped and said, "Enjoy your downfall," and sashayed back inside the hall.
Dawn looked up at the sky. There was a burning sensation in her eyes. She berated her father, "Why didn't you listen to me? Why did you get Helena? Couldn't you look into the future? See what we are left with. Are you happy?" Her shoulders shook as a wave of emotions passed through her body. She walked to sit on the bench and closed her eyes. Am image of Daryn flashed across her mind – of how he smiled with her, how he made her feel complete and how much he trusted her. The confidence that drained from her body returned with full force. She clenched her fists. So it was Niall who gave them her whereabouts. They all hatched a plan to get her from Bradford for their selfish reasons on the pretext of offering her a job. Why did Azura betray her trust? It was so twisted. She got up from her place and walked inside the hall.
As soon as she stepped inside, she heard the pure bloods snickering at her.
"Such a shameless neotide!"
"She stole Daryn from Maya."
"Maya is depressed because of her."
"Poor Maya, she is so insulted, yet plan on forgiving Daryn."
"Yes, this bitch should walk out from their lives even if she has an ounce of dignity left."
Advertisement
With her head held high, Dawn continued to walk to where Daryn was standing. Pia and Caleb were scolding him for being such a douchebag.
"Please don't scold him," Maya urged. "It is not his fault." She looked at Dawn and pointed at her with angry eyes and contorted face. "It is her fault for seducing Daryn. My Daryn is not like this. We have known each other for ages. Humph! We will get over her." Suddenly in a raised voice she said, "She is the cause of my depression. We had called the neotides to foster our relationships, but it is the neotides like her who can't tolerate good things." She looked at her father and said, "Father, please throw her out. One rotten fish will dirty the entire pond." She started crying.
Her mother came to her and held her rubbed her shoulders as she stared at Dawn. "We love peace and don't disturb anyone's life. Please leave this place," she pleaded Dawn.
Dawn shook her head at the theatrics of Maya. She huffed and caught Daryn's hand. Daryn took a deep breath and looked at Neal. Neal in turn raised his right hand in the air as if gesturing someone and suddenly a recorded conversation started playing,
["Maya: Father, I need your help."
Brad: "In what way? I will send more money if you want, but don't call again and again."
Maya: "I want you to send some of your men to kill a few neotides and make it look like that it was the Silvers who did it."]
Everyone in the hall was stunned. A silence fell upon all the guests.
Maya's face became pale like ghost. It was the conversation she had with her father when she wanted to kill Dawn. She looked up and around as to where was the sound coming from.
"What is going on?" Brad shouted. It was his home and he was in the center of a major controversy.
[Brad: "What? Are you mad? Why would I do that? If Daryn comes to know about these senseless killings, he would take two minutes to break his engagement with you. As such he is not on good terms with you."
Maya: "He is already going to break it."
"Why?"]
Maya screamed, "Stop it!"
Her mother left her shoulders as she watched the guests. Blood drained from her face.
Maya found the recorder and ran towards it like lifting her dress. She had planned a perfect showdown for Dawn and Daryn and was certain that Dawn would be insulted and thrown out of the community of the pure bloods. She had even called Jason to do the closure so that she would be chucked out of the community of the neotides but how did had the tables turn?
[Maya: I don't know father. I just want you to kill a neotide called Dawn Wyatt also.]
Maya reached the recorder. She picked it up and threw it on the ground to smash it. There was a slight pause. Her mouth became dry and heart palpitated heavily. "Who planted this recorder here?" she yelled. "This is all bogus and fake. Someone is trying to tarnish my father's reputation and mine."
